10 May, 2009 - Australian Corporate Writing (ACW) has announced the appointment of two new key team members. Joining the company in July 2009 will be Ms. Cathy Schapper, who will assume the role of Business Manager and National Network of Professionals Manager, and Mr. Andrew Schapper, will will take over as Media Portfolio Manager.
According to ACW Managing Director and Founder, Keir Wells, the two new appointments mark a major turning point in the company's growth.
'For over 15 years we've been leading the industry in the provision of corporate writing, media and support services,' Mr. Wells said. 'Now, though, as more and more of our clients are relying on us to function as their primary marketing support partner, we have taken the next step forward and restructured the company to best meet the needs of our clients.
'With Cathy and Andrew on board our clients are set to benefit from even greater levels of responsiveness, accountability and - as has always been our focus point - quality.'
'An outstanding level of personal service'
As a result of the new appointments, ACW is in a stronger than ever position to maintain its personal client management practices while enhancing its highly acclaimed service offerings, particularly in the company's Media Portfolio.
'We've always been proud of the fact that every one of our clients is afforded personal service without the cost overheads associated with companies bogged down by layers of management,' Mr. Wells stated.
'When we saw it was time to expand our service offerings we recognised the opportunity - not a challenge - to expand our team and provide an outstanding level of personal service well beyond any industry standard.
'Both Cathy and Andrew are talented writers and team managers,' Mr. Wells continued. 'In joining the ACW team they're enabling us to increase our depth of writing and media skills while enhancing our client service.'
